Sweet Potato Cutlet is a flavorful and wholesome snack made from mashed sweet potatoes blended with roasted semolina, bread crumbs, fresh coriander leaves and a few more ingredients, and shaped into cutlets. They are deep- fried until golden and crispy. This delicious and easy-to-make cutlet is perfect for tea time as an evening snack. Sweet Potato Cutlet

Ingredients for Sweet Potato Cutlet:

  1. Sweet potato boiled and smashed – 2 cups
  2. Roasted rava – ½ cup
  3. Onions chopped fine – 1
  4. Ginger chopped fine – 1 tablespoon
  5. Green chillies – 2, chopped
  6. Coriander leaves – 1 stem
  7. Turmeric powder – ½ tsp
  8. Salt – A pinch
  9. Egg – 1
  10. Bread crumbs – As required

How to prepare Sweet Potato Cutlet?

  1. Add fried semolina, onion, ginger, green chillies, coriander leaves, turmeric powder, and salt to the smashed sweet potato.
  2. Shape the mixture into cutlets.
  3. Dip each cutlet in beaten egg and coat well with bread crumbs.
  4. Heat the oil and deep-fry the cutlets until they turn golden brown.
  5. Flip both sides of the cutlets to make them crispy.
  6. Serve hot with a cup of tea.
